Captain tom Moore is 100 on april 30th and wanted to raise £1000 by walking 100 laps of his garden with his zimmer frame as a way of thanking the nhs for his hip replacement. He has,at last look raised over £7,000,000. Surely this deserves a knighthood?

Additional Information

Tom was born and brought up in Keighley, Yorkshire. He went to Keighley Grammar School and later completed an apprenticeship as a Civil Engineer. Tom went onto being enlisted in 8 DWR (145 RAC) at the beginning of the war, and in 1940 was selected for Officer training. He was later posted to 9DWR in India, and served and fought on the Arakan, went to Regiment to Sumatra after the Japanese surrender and returned to be Instructor at Armoured Fighting Vehicle School in Bovington.

This petition was rejected

The Government e-Petitions Team gave the following reason:

We know lots of people want to petition for Colonel Moore to receive an honour, but the Government will only accept individual nominations, not petitions, so we can’t publish your petition.
